WebThe last month of the spring, May, is also a wintry month in Tromsø, Norway, with an average temperature varying between 0.8°C (33.4°F) and 5°C (41°F). Temperature In May, the average high-temperature marginally rises from a cold 0.7°C (33.3°F) in April to a still wintry 5°C (41°F). In May, the average low-temperature is 0.8°C (33.4°F). (March 2024) Operation Haudegen ( Unternehmen Haudegen [Operation Broadsword ]) was the name of a German operation during the Second World War to establish meteorological stations on Svalbard. In September 1944, the submarine U-307 and the supply ship Carl J. Busch transported the …

Web5 dec. 2024 · Summer: June, July, August. The most popular time to visit is also when the weather is at its mildest and most stable. The sun sets late in the evening, and on warm days you can enjoy a refreshing dip in the fjords and lakes.
